Increase horsepower with legal, bolt-on modifications like a cold air intake (5-15 hp), a cat-back exhaust (5-15 hp), or the two combined (22-32 hp) — and pairing either with an ECU tune pushes the combined gain higher still, often into the 25-50+ hp range on a properly matched setup. Bigger gains beyond that generally require more invasive engine work, not simple bolt-on parts.
Here’s what each common modification actually delivers, why combining them compounds the gain, and what stays street-legal depending on where you live.

Cold Air Intake: The Common First Mod
A cold air intake typically adds about 5-15 horsepower, with larger engines, turbocharged setups, or vehicles paired with a proper tune seeing gains closer to 15-20 hp. It’s a relatively affordable, straightforward install that improves airflow, throttle response, and intake sound without requiring major engine work (Pedal Commander).
The mechanism is simple: cooler, denser air contains more oxygen per volume than the warm air a factory intake often pulls from near the hot engine bay, and more oxygen available for combustion means more potential power. Smaller engines tend to land on the lower end of the gain range; larger or turbocharged engines, which can take advantage of the additional airflow more fully, see more.

Cat-Back Exhaust: A Similar, Separate Gain
A cat-back exhaust system — everything from the catalytic converter back to the tailpipe — typically adds about 5-15 hp at the wheels, though real-world gains often land in the single digits unless paired with other modifications (Flashark).
The gain comes from reduced exhaust backpressure, letting the engine expel spent gases more efficiently rather than fighting against a restrictive factory system. It’s a legal modification in most states as long as the catalytic converter itself stays intact and noise output stays under local decibel limits.
Combined Gains: Why the Mods Stack
Combining a cold air intake with a cat-back exhaust can produce a total horsepower increase of 22-32 hp, more than either modification’s individual range suggests, since improved airflow in and improved exhaust flow out work together rather than against each other (OnAllCylinders). Layer in an ECU tune and the combined effect can reach 25-50+ hp, since the factory engine computer isn’t calibrated for the increased airflow those parts create — a tune recalibrates fuel and ignition timing to actually use the extra air rather than leaving performance on the table.

What Stays Legal (and What Doesn’t)
Most performance parts sold in California specifically require a CARB Executive Order (EO) number proving they don’t increase emissions — a cold air intake without the correct EO for your specific vehicle isn’t street legal there, even if it’s a popular, widely sold product (Legal Overview).
Exhaust modifications carry a separate risk: California caps exhaust noise, and exceeding 95 decibels can result in a citation up to $1,000. The general rule that keeps most bolt-on modifications legal: leave emissions equipment (the catalytic converter, in particular) intact, and confirm any part you’re installing carries the right compliance certification for your state before buying.
Keep the Engine Healthy Enough to Actually Use the Power
None of these modifications matter much if the underlying engine isn’t in good running condition. Fresh spark plugs and properly scheduled oil changes keep combustion efficient enough to actually take advantage of the additional airflow these mods provide — a worn plug or degraded oil undercuts any horsepower gain from bolt-on parts before it ever reaches the wheels.
Frequently Asked Questions
Do horsepower mods void my warranty?
They can, particularly for engine and drivetrain coverage related to the modified system. The Magnuson-Moss Warranty Act limits how much a manufacturer can deny unrelated claims, but a dealer can reasonably deny coverage on a component the modification directly affected.
Is a tune alone worth it without intake and exhaust changes?
It can provide a modest gain on a completely stock engine by optimizing existing airflow more efficiently, but the bigger gains come from pairing a tune with the physical airflow improvements an intake and exhaust provide — a tune amplifies what the hardware makes possible rather than creating airflow on its own.
How much horsepower can I gain without any engine internals work?
Bolt-on modifications like intake, exhaust, and tuning together commonly land in the 25-50+ hp range for naturally aspirated engines, sometimes more on turbocharged platforms where a tune can also safely increase boost. Beyond that typically requires more invasive work like forced induction upgrades or internal engine modifications.
Are these modifications worth it for daily driving, or just performance use?
Most bolt-on mods in this range are fine for daily driving and don’t meaningfully hurt reliability when installed and tuned correctly, though a louder exhaust or firmer intake sound is a lifestyle tradeoff some daily drivers don’t want.
